Metal Roofing for Skyline Homes Near Anacortes

The Skyline area sits close enough to the water that every roof up here deals with the same three things year-round: salt-laden air off the Salish Sea, long stretches of driving rain, and a moss season that can run from fall clear through spring. A roof that works fine in a drier inland part of Skagit County doesn't always hold up the same way out here. Metal roofing, installed correctly for this specific environment, is one of the more reliable answers to that problem — but "installed correctly" is doing a lot of work in that sentence, and it's worth understanding what that actually means before you commit to a system or a contractor.

What This Climate Actually Does to a Roof

Anacortes and the surrounding Skyline neighborhoods get a combination of exposures that not every roofing product handles well over the long haul.

Salt Air

Homes closer to the water are exposed to airborne salt that settles on every exterior surface, including the roof. Over years, that salt exposure accelerates corrosion on unprotected or poorly coated metal fasteners and flashing. It doesn't mean metal roofing is a bad choice near the water — it means the coating, the fastener grade, and the flashing details all matter more here than they would forty miles inland.

Driving Rain

Wind off the water pushes rain sideways, not just straight down. That changes how water moves across a roof surface and around penetrations — vents, chimneys, skylights — and it's why underlayment quality and flashing technique matter as much as the roofing material itself. A roof that only handles vertical rainfall well will eventually leak here.

Moss and Sustained Moisture

Tree cover, shade, and long damp stretches mean moss and algae growth are a near-constant pressure on roofs in this area. Moss holds moisture against a roof surface, and on some materials that trapped moisture leads to premature wear. Metal roofing doesn't eliminate moss growth entirely — spores can still land and take hold in debris or grime — but a smooth, sealed metal surface gives moss far less to grip onto than a textured or porous material, and it's much easier to keep clean.

Why Metal Roofing Makes Sense for Skyline Specifically

We don't push metal roofing on every home — it's a real investment, and the right material depends on the house, the budget, and the roofline. But for Skyline's particular mix of salt air, wind-driven rain, and moss pressure, metal has some real advantages worth weighing:

  • Sheds moisture fast. Steep-shed metal panels don't give water or debris much surface to sit on, which matters when rain is coming in sideways for days at a time.
  • Resists moss anchoring. A smooth painted or coated metal surface is a poor host for moss compared to rougher roofing textures — less for spores and debris to grab onto.
  • Long service life when detailed correctly. A properly installed and maintained metal roof can outlast several cycles of shorter-lived materials, which matters given how much labor and disruption a full roof replacement involves.
  • Handles wind well. Panel systems with proper fastening resist wind uplift better than lighter-weight materials, which is relevant on the more exposed lots around Skyline.
  • Lower long-term maintenance once installed correctly, though "correctly" still requires periodic inspection — see below.

Metal Roofing Options We Install

Not all metal roofing is the same product wearing different colors. The system you choose affects cost, appearance, and how it performs in this specific climate.

SystemHow It's FastenedBest FitTrade-Offs
Standing seamConcealed clips, no exposed fasteners on the fieldHomes closest to the water or under heavy tree coverHigher material and labor cost; best long-term performance against moisture and corrosion
Exposed-fastener panelScrews driven through the panel face into gasketsBudget-conscious projects, outbuildings, secondary structuresFasteners and gaskets need periodic inspection and eventual replacement — more of a maintenance item near salt air
Stone-coated steelConcealed fastening under an interlocking stone-granule panelHomeowners who want a shingle or tile look with metal's durabilityMore seams and profile detail to flash correctly around penetrations

For most Skyline homes with real salt exposure, we lean toward standing seam or a high-quality concealed-fastener system, simply because there are fewer points where a fastener penetrates the panel and becomes a future corrosion or leak point. Exposed-fastener panels aren't a bad product — they're a legitimate, cost-effective choice for the right building — but they carry a higher maintenance burden in this specific environment, and we'll tell you that plainly rather than sell around it.

What a Correct Installation Actually Involves

Metal roofing fails early almost exclusively because of installation mistakes, not because the material itself is weak. A few details matter more here than in a drier climate:

Underlayment

A synthetic, high-temperature underlayment rated for the panel type goes down first, with extra ice-and-water membrane at eaves, valleys, and around every penetration — the places wind-driven rain is most likely to find a way in.

Fastener and Flashing Material

Fasteners, flashing, and trim need to be matched in metal type to the panel to avoid galvanic corrosion, and rated for coastal or marine exposure. This is a detail that's easy to cut corners on and hard to catch until years later when corrosion starts showing at the fastener heads.

Ventilation

Metal roofs need proper ridge and intake ventilation so moisture from inside the attic doesn't condense against the underside of cold metal panels. In a climate this damp, poor attic ventilation is one of the more common causes of hidden moisture problems under an otherwise sound roof.

Valley and Penetration Detailing

Valleys, chimney flashing, and vent boots are where the vast majority of roof leaks originate — on any roofing material. With wind-driven rain, these details need to be built to shed water moving sideways and upward under wind pressure, not just water flowing straight downhill.

Maintenance in a Moss-Prone, Salt-Air Climate

Metal roofing is lower-maintenance than most materials, but "lower" isn't "none." In Skagit County's moss season, a couple of habits go a long way:

  • Clear debris — needles, leaves, moss clumps — from valleys and around penetrations at least once a year, more often under heavy tree cover.
  • Keep gutters clear so water isn't backing up against the eave edge during heavy rain events.
  • Have flashing and sealant points at chimneys, vents, and skylights checked periodically — these age faster than the panels themselves.
  • Trim back overhanging branches where practical to reduce moss spore load and debris buildup on the roof surface.
  • If you notice fastener corrosion, loose panels, or granule loss (on stone-coated systems), address it early — small fixes now prevent bigger repairs later.

FAQ

Frequently asked questions

How long does a metal roof last compared to other roofing materials?

A properly installed metal roof with correct fasteners and flashing typically outlasts asphalt shingles by a wide margin, often by several decades, though actual lifespan depends heavily on the coating quality and how well penetrations were detailed during installation. In salt-air environments like Skyline, fastener and flashing material choice matters as much as the panel itself for hitting that lifespan.

What should I ask a contractor before hiring them for a metal roofing job?

Ask what underlayment and ice-and-water coverage they use at valleys and penetrations, what fastener and flashing metal they spec for coastal exposure, and whether they carry proper licensing and insurance for your project. Ask to see how they handle attic ventilation too, since that's a detail often skipped and one that causes hidden problems later.

Are all metal roofing panels coated the same way?

No — coating quality varies significantly between products, from basic painted finishes to more advanced multi-layer coatings designed to resist fading and corrosion. In a salt-air, high-moisture climate like this one, the coating spec matters more than it would in a drier inland area, so it's worth asking specifically what coating system is being quoted.

What's the difference between screw-down and standing-seam metal panels in terms of upkeep?

Screw-down panels have exposed fasteners with rubber gaskets that compress over time and eventually need inspection or replacement, while standing-seam panels use concealed clips with no fastener penetrations through the panel face. Near the water, that difference shows up as more periodic maintenance for screw-down systems versus a longer maintenance-free stretch for standing seam.

Does being close to the water in Anacortes actually change what roofing materials hold up best?

Yes — homes closer to the Salish Sea deal with more airborne salt, which accelerates corrosion on unprotected metal components and puts more stress on flashing and fastener choices than roofs further inland. It doesn't rule out metal roofing, but it does mean coating grade, fastener material, and flashing detail all need to be specified for coastal exposure rather than a generic inland install.
